School of Noise – Listen & Play sessions support babies and toddlers to develop their listening and musical skills as they begin their journey through the sonic world around them.

What to expect

During these weekly sessions, babies, toddlers and their parents/guardians will be able to listen to lots of different sounds, dance and move, and play music together. The classes include percussion instruments to play on, visual projections, fascinating facts, lights and bubbles!

Listen & Play is intended to be just as fun and interesting for grown-ups as well as their children. Each week is different so it’s a perfect event to pop to when you have a spare morning with your little one!

The music played isn’t traditional children’s songs and nursery rhymes, instead, we play music from a variety of different genres and artists including Brian Eno, Bjork, Kraftwerk, Four Tet, Miles Davis and Delia Derbyshire.
